Subject: Key rotation for Gridpatch bulk edits — tonight

Hey, quick heads-up for whoever's on call: we're rotating the credential the Gridpatch admin table uses for bulk edits at 22:00. Single-row edits aren't affected. If the bulk-edit queue starts throwing 401s after the cutover, just swap in the new credential and restart the worker. Here's the new key.

app token of yajeg-kawef = kto11_7En3XSX8xQw

## Tuning

Graftprobe samples GPU memory at a fixed interval and flushes snapshots to disk in batches. Plugin authors: do not poll faster than the sampler interval; you will read duplicates. All knobs are read once at init. Overrides go in the plugin manifest, not env vars. Exceeding the snapshot cap truncates oldest-first, silently. The defaults shipped with the current release are listed below.

tuning table, kajog-kawef:
PRIORITIES = {
    "kelox": 870,
    "kasix": 89,
    "eliax": 988,
}

### Step 4: Configure the Nightscribe Scheduler

Nightscribe replaces the old cron wrapper for nightly backfills on the Marlon data platform. Each backfill job is declared in the scheduler manifest with a window, concurrency cap, and retry policy. New team members should copy the staging manifest before editing. Apply the following baseline configuration before enabling any jobs.

settings of tajep-yahif:
[praion]
team = praax
access_code = ac_2cf0e2
owner = istox.aldmir
host = praion.lumicsoft.local
port = 9090
peer = aldax.qorvelcloud.local
salt = c327c8e8
pin = 1997

Action item from the Mirewater tide-table widget incident. Owner: release manager. Widget cached stale harbor offsets after the DST change, showing tides six hours off for two days. Required: add a cache-invalidation check to the release checklist, block deploys when offset tables are older than 24 hours, and verify the Saltgate harbor feed before each cut. Deadline: next release. Checklist template and sign-off procedure are documented on the internal page below.

wiki page, kawif-bajep: https://artifactory.zarqelforge.internal/issue/browse/display/display/projects/spaces/secrets/000fe6ec5a46af29355003e1